Severe asthma manifests as airway remodeling and irreversible airway obstruction, in part because of the proliferation and migration of human airway smooth muscle (HASM) cells. We previously reported that cyclic adenosine monophosphate-mobilizing agents, including β(2)-adrenergic receptor (β(2)AR) agonists, which are mainstay of asthma therapy, and prostaglandin E2 (PGE2), inhibit the migration of HASM cells, although the mechanism for this migration remains unknown. Vasodilator-stimulated phosphoprotein (VASP), an anticapping protein, modulates the formation of actin stress fibers during cell motility, and is negatively regulated by protein kinase A (PKA)-specific inhibitory phosphorylation at serine 157 (Ser157). Here, we show that treatment with β(2)AR agonists and PGE2 induces the PKA-dependent phosphorylation of VASP and inhibits the migration of HASM cells. The stable expression of PKA inhibitory peptide and the small interfering (si) RNA-induced depletion of VASP abolish the inhibitory effects of albuterol and PGE2 on the migration of HASM cells. Importantly, prolonged treatment with albuterol prevents the agonist-induced phosphorylation of VASP at Ser157, and reverses the inhibitory effects of albuterol and formoterol, but not PGE2, on the basal and PDGF-induced migration of HASM cells. Collectively, our data demonstrate that β(2)AR agonists selectively inhibit the migration of HASM cells via a β(2)AR/PKA/VASP signaling pathway, and that prolonged treatment with albuterol abolishes the inhibitory effect of β-agonists on the phosphorylation of VASP and migration of HASM cells because of β(2)AR desensitization.  相似文献

MotivationGenetic factors determine differences in pharmacokinetics, drug efficacy, and drug responses between individuals and sub-populations. Wrong dosages of drugs can lead to severe adverse drug reactions in individuals whose drug metabolism drastically differs from the “assumed average”. Databases such as PharmGKB are excellent sources of pharmacogenetic information on enzymes, genetic variants, and drug response affected by changes in enzymatic activity. Here, we seek to aid researchers, database curators, and clinicians in their search for relevant information by automatically extracting these data from literature.ApproachWe automatically populate a repository of information on genetic variants, relations to drugs, occurrence in sub-populations, and associations with disease. We mine textual data from PubMed abstracts to discover such genotype–phenotype associations, focusing on SNPs that can be associated with variations in drug response. The overall repository covers relations found between genes, variants, alleles, drugs, diseases, adverse drug reactions, populations, and allele frequencies. We cross-reference these data to EntrezGene, PharmGKB, PubChem, and others.ResultsThe performance regarding entity recognition and relation extraction yields a precision of 90–92% for the major entity types (gene, drug, disease), and 76–84% for relations involving these types. Comparison of our repository to PharmGKB reveals a coverage of 93% of gene–drug associations in PharmGKB and 97% of the gene–variant mappings based on 180,000 PubMed abstracts.Availabilityhttp://bioai4core.fulton.asu.edu/snpshot.  相似文献

Experiments on rats with myocardium infarction showed that intravenous administration of etoxidol in a dose of 14.2 mg/kg restricted the size of necrosis area and reduced the ratio of necrosis/ischemia zones. The test compound reduced the risk of rhythm and conduction disturbances induced by administration of toxic epinephrine doses to the mice, and increased mouse survival. Etoxidol administered intravenously to cats with acute myocardial ischemia reduced epinephrine concentration and intensity of free radical oxidation in zones of myocardial lesions against the background of the increase in norepinephrine concentration and antioxidant activity in the myocardium. By antiischemic and antioxidant activity, etoxidol was superior to its structural analogue mexidol.  相似文献

The TCR repertoire is a mirror of the human immune system that reflects processes caused by infections, cancer, autoimmunity, and aging. Next generation sequencing (NGS) is becoming a powerful tool for deep TCR profiling; yet, questions abound regarding the methodological approaches for sample preparation and correct data interpretation. Accumulated PCR and sequencing errors along with library preparation bottlenecks and uneven PCR efficiencies lead to information loss, biased quantification, and generation of huge artificial TCR diversity. Here, we compare Illumina, 454, and Ion Torrent platforms for individual TCR profiling, evaluate the rate and character of errors, and propose advanced platform‐specific algorithms to correct massive sequencing data. These developments are applicable to a wide variety of next generation sequencing applications. We demonstrate that advanced correction allows the removal of the majority of artificial TCR diversity with concomitant rescue of most of the sequencing information. Thus, this correction enhances the accuracy of clonotype identification and quantification as well as overall TCR diversity measurements.  相似文献

We analyzed the clinicopathologic features of 10 cases of vulvovaginal myofibroblastoma to widen its morphological and immunohistochemical spectrum. Most tumors (8/10 cases) were located in the vagina. The patients' age ranged from 44 to 77 years, and tumor size ranged from 0.4 to 3 cm. Histologically, 5 tumors had the characteristics of vulvovaginal myofibroblastoma. In addition, we identified 3 cases composed of spindle-shaped cells arranged in short fascicles with intervening thick collagen bands, closely reminiscent of mammary myofibroblastoma. Notably, 1 case resembled Sertoli cell tumor, sclerosing type, because of its predominant cord-like arrangement. In another case, there were highly cellular areas composed of uniform-packed, rounded cells that, at low magnification, looked like a malignant "small round blue cell tumor." A variably thick band of native connective tissue separated tumors from the overlying squamous epithelium even if, in 3 cases, tumor cells extended up to the epithelium. In 7 cases, a variable number of vessels showed perivascular hyalinization. Only rare mitotic figures were identified. All tumors were diffusely positive for vimentin, desmin, and CD99. A variable staining intensity was observed for CD34, Bcl-2, B-cell lymphoma 2 (Bcl-2) CD10, estrogen receptor, and progesterone receptor in most cases, but none expressed α-smooth muscle actin. We emphasize that vulvovaginal myofibroblastoma encompasses a morphological spectrum wider than previously described. The overlapping morphological and immunohistochemical features of vulvovaginal and mammary myofibroblastomas led us to speculate that these are related entities with morphological variations on a common basic theme likely dependent on anatomical location.  相似文献

ABSTRACT:: Two unusual Carney complex patients are described. In one of them, several cutaneous biopsies revealed myxoid lesions that were rather more close to authentic adnexal neoplasms with myxoid stroma than to a "myxoma with an epithelial component." These included lesions resembling trichofolliculoma, infundibular cyst, and trichodiscoma. Additionally, 1 soft tissue myxoma was unique in the sense that it greatly resembled a cardiac myxoma, begging the question whether this could represent an embolus from the patient's cardiac myxoma. Given the large size and complexity and heterogeneity of the cutaneous lesions, the authors suggest that these may represent authentic cutaneous neoplasms accompanied by myxoid stroma and not adnexal elements induced by the stroma. However, the latter mechanism is well recognized and demonstrated by our second patient in whom adnexal-type elements in the cutaneous lesion were clearly induced by the myxoid stroma but were unusually complex by manifesting panfollicular and also sebaceous differentiation.  相似文献

ABSTRACT:: The authors report on a case of panfolliculoma with sebaceous differentiation occurring on the scalp of a 53-year-old white man and discuss the pertinent literature.  相似文献
